Nathan Lambert argues that while we have evidence AI agents are good at improving software used to train AI and LLMs can be superhuman in many domains, these do not combine into 'AI will be so powerful it will kill us in N years' — that forecasts inevitable saturation and unknown breakthroughs. A replier counters that the distinction between 'impossible' and 'negligibly unlikely' matters, and in the limit we are already there. A serious technical debate on self-improving AI risk.
